Monday, 13 March 2017

Vintage Mash


Yesterday was a perfect day for the monthly Stockport Vintage Village event
The sun shone, the scooter clubs came along and the music was fantastic.


We met up with many Instagram friends including Ericka and Phil
who travelled over from Sheffield


I found some fabulous knitwear. 
This Scotch Wool Shop shetland wool cardigan


and this super gorgeous handknitted waistcoat was
£5 from Make Do & Mend


Garbo Vintage & Antiques had this floral cotton smock.
Just my thing at the moment and I've styled it
with a charity shop find top and the mad tights
friend Vix gave me last year




The red and green polyester dresses came from  The Queens Drawers 
who I get a lot of my clobber off and they are teamed up with 
£1.50 cardigans of Todmorden secondhand market.


Look at Mr Dapper Chap in his new overcoat
off Mick at Garbo Vintage & Antiques


 He hardly looks like the wandering welder in this lot.


 The little hair clips on Lollipop Vintages stall reminded 
me of being a little girl and mum putting them in my hair


We couldn't come home without a pile of 
cakes off Stuart Thornley Cake Designs, it 
would have been rude to leave them behind.


My favourite find of the fair was this 50's Barkcloth
skirt off Jane Hamilton and right next to Jane I picked up from Sheila's Store
this handknitted top which goes perfectly with the skirt


MASHing different patterns, era's, styles,textures and colours together 
is my favourite pastime right now.  The more MASHed the better.

Even though I look like I've blown the budget you will be pleased to know
that I came home £16 in pocket and with the red and green dress for free.
You see I had taken a pile of clobber with me to sell on.
I do love vintage shopping with the added advantage of knowing I am doing my 
bit for the enviroment by recycling over and over the same clothes. Yay !
